Output 568eb00f5bc08b45de88a2d1396a8369b16167295f207fb25b9977575c6125f2:23

value
1577333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 270ebda8645a7c489172038ca9566603acb56bec OP_EQUAL
address
35FXwEisqRo6NPd8jZ1Z7vxMJaYqMwchsm
transaction
568eb00f5bc08b45de88a2d1396a8369b16167295f207fb25b9977575c6125f2
spent
true